#7548EF Hex color

#7548EF

The hexadecimal color code #7548EF corresponds to the code RGB( 117, 72, 239 ). It's a shade of Blue. This color is a combination of red (at 0,46 level), green (at 0,28 level) and blue (at 0,94 level). Its brightness is 60% and its saturation is 83%. It is composed of red at 27%, green at 16% and blue at 55%.
